Transaction 96d44d7572e4e1335667b6fa38b163f5dc731aacc68f0ad3cfaf74c9c8623871
1 Input
1 Output
-
96d44d7572e4e1335667b6fa38b163f5dc731aacc68f0ad3cfaf74c9c8623871:0
- value
- 1605684
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ebf1a695b31cd6f1f513651228d24f1df8d25107
- address
- bc1qa0c6d9dnrnt0ragnv5fz35j0rhudy5g8zs0ntl